Managing Mango Trees: A Comprehensive Guide315
Introduction
Mangoes, with their luscious pulp and sweet aroma, are a tropical delicacy enjoyed worldwide. Growing these trees successfully requires proper management techniques to ensure optimal fruit yield and tree health. This guide will provide comprehensive instructions on how to manage mango trees, covering essential aspects such as planting, watering, fertilization, pest and disease control, and harvesting.
Planting
Choose a well-draining planting site that receives ample sunlight. Dig a hole twice the width of the root ball and equally deep. Amend the soil with organic matter like compost or manure to improve drainage and fertility. Carefully remove the mango tree from its container and place it in the hole, ensuring the graft union (where the rootstock and scion are joined) remains above the soil level. Backfill with soil, tamp gently to remove air pockets, and water deeply.
Watering
Newly planted mango trees require regular watering to establish a healthy root system. Water deeply and infrequently, allowing the soil to dry out slightly between waterings. As the tree matures, its water requirements will increase. During the fruiting season, provide consistent moisture to support fruit development. Avoid overwatering, as this can lead to root rot.
Fertilization
Mango trees benefit from regular fertilization to replenish essential nutrients. Use a balanced fertilizer that provides n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ium. Apply the fertilizer in a circle around the tree, keeping it a few inches away from the trunk. Water deeply after fertilizing to promote nutrient absorption. Fertilize young trees every 2-3 months and established trees every 4-6 months.
Pest and Disease Control
Several pests and diseases can affect mango trees. Common pests include aphids, mealybugs, and fruit flies. Monitor your trees regularly for signs of infestation and treat accordingly using appropriate insecticides. For disease prevention, practice good sanitation by removing fallen leaves and fruit from around the tree. Also, provide adequate spacing between trees to promote air circulation and reduce disease risk.
Pruning
Proper pruning helps shape the tree, promote fruit production, and remove diseased or damaged branches. Prune young trees to establish a strong framework. Remove any suckers or water sprouts that grow from the base of the tree. As the tree matures, thin out overcrowded branches to improve air circulation and light penetration. Always use sharp and clean pruning tools.
Harvesting
Mangoes ripen on the tree. Allow the fruit to develop a full yellow or orange color before harvesting. Gently twist or cut the fruit from the stem, taking care not to damage the tree. Handle the fruit with care to avoid bruising. Store ripe mangoes at room temperature for a few days or refrigerate them for longer storage.
